简介
在前端开发中,我们常常需要使用缓存来提高应用性能和用户体验。而 npm 包 helper-cache 就是一款能够帮助我们实现缓存的工具。该工具能够自动对数据进行缓存,并且支持设置自动过期时间。
安装
我们可以使用 npm 来安装 helper-cache:
npm install helper-cache --save
使用
在使用 helper-cache 时,我们需要先引入该工具:
const helperCache = require('helper-cache');
然后,我们就可以通过该工具提供的方法来实现缓存了。
存储数据
我们可以使用 put
方法来将数据存储到缓存中。该方法接受两个参数:缓存键和数据。
helperCache.put('mykey', 'myvalue');
取出数据
我们可以使用 get
方法来从缓存中取出数据。该方法接受一个参数:缓存键。
const myValue = helperCache.get('mykey');
如果缓存中不存在对应的键值,则 get
方法会返回 null。
设置过期时间
我们可以使用 putWithDuration
方法来设置缓存数据的过期时间。该方法接受三个参数:缓存键、数据和过期时间(秒)。
helperCache.putWithDuration('mykey', 'myvalue', 60); // 数据将在 60 秒后过期
清空缓存
我们可以使用 flush
方法来清空缓存中所有的数据。
helperCache.flush();
示例
下面是一个示例,用来在 Node.js 中使用 helper-cache 存储和获取数据:
-- -------------------- ---- ------- ----- ----------- - ------------------------ -- ---- ----------------------- ---------- -- ---- ----- ------ - ------------------------ -- ------ -- -------- -- ------------- -- - ----------------------------------- --------- ---- -- ---- ----- ------ - ------------------------ -- ------ -- -------- -- -- -- -- ----- ------------ - ------------------------ -- ------------ -- ----
总结
helper-cache 是一款简单易用的缓存工具。通过使用该工具,我们可以轻松地实现数据缓存,提高应用性能和用户体验。希望本文能帮助你学习如何使用 helper-cache,并将其应用到你的项目中。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5eedc4bbb5cbfe1ea06121a4